Although I must agree with Knersus above, I was at Voda(com)world last week too (despite my dislike of the place) and there was almost no sign of the One X. No posters, no ads, and only the dummy phone (and the very disinterested dummy behind the counter) in the shop. The place was swarming with Galaxy S3 posters, every shop had at least one actual S3 you could play with (the Samsung shop had about 10 of them), kids with Samsung t-shirts were also walking around with phones for people to try, flyers were handed out, everything. None of that influenced my decision apart from having the opportunity to try the phone out. That's what did it for me. The htc launched globally a good while before the Samsung and they couldn't even be arsed to have a single one to try out. That leads me to believe they're not really serious about selling the phone in SA and thus finding accessories or support for it will be near impossible. After having experienced that with the Motorola RAZR (which is a brilliant phone, but I had to wait 1.5 months for a pouch from overseas because Motorola doesn't give a shyte about having an SA presence) I decided that if phone companies don't want my money, why should I go out of my way?
If that doesn't bother you, get the One X, I'm sure it's a great phone, apart from not having an SD card slot. If it does bother you, get a Galaxy S3.
